In the second episode of this three-part series focusing on director/officer liability, Rob Gerberry, Senior Vice President & Chief Legal Officer, Summa Health, speaks with Michael Peregrine, Partner, McDermott Will & Emery LLP, about the parties that have primary jurisdiction to challenge officer and director conduct. They discuss the different tiers of parties that have an interest in officer and director conduct, the kinds of circumstances that can create exposure with these parties, and mitigation measures that officers and directors can take to protect themselves from actions by these parties.
